The Prime Minister's Office has called a meeting with higher officials from Kerala this afternoon to discuss security at Sabarimala during the pilgrimage season.

The meeting is being convened against the background of a broad perception of security threat from terrorists against places of worship including Sabarimala.

Additional Chief Secretary (Home) K. Jayakumar and Director General of Police Jacob Punnoose will be attending the meeting to be presided over by the Principal Secretary to the Prime Minister T. K. A. Nair.

The Director General had inspected security arrangements at Sabarimala on Sunday in preparation for the meeting.
